新聞中心
linux Init進程是Linux操作系統(tǒng)中最重要的部分,用于完成系統(tǒng)啟動、初始化及系統(tǒng)服務(wù)的啟動等任務(wù)。它是啟動系統(tǒng)時第一個被加載運行的程序,負責(zé)管理、監(jiān)控和初始化整個操作系統(tǒng),是整個操作系統(tǒng)正常運行的基礎(chǔ)。

創(chuàng)新互聯(lián)是專業(yè)的貢山網(wǎng)站建設(shè)公司,貢山接單;提供成都網(wǎng)站制作、做網(wǎng)站,網(wǎng)頁設(shè)計,網(wǎng)站設(shè)計,建網(wǎng)站,PHP網(wǎng)站建設(shè)等專業(yè)做網(wǎng)站服務(wù);采用PHP框架,可快速的進行貢山網(wǎng)站開發(fā)網(wǎng)頁制作和功能擴展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團隊,希望更多企業(yè)前來合作!
任何操作系統(tǒng)都需要一個init進程來啟動和管理操作系統(tǒng)中的其他進程,而Linux正是如此。linux init進程的重要性在于,它不僅可以按照指定的腳本來完成操作系統(tǒng)的初始化,還可以啟動系統(tǒng)所需的服務(wù),從而使整個操作系統(tǒng)處于穩(wěn)定可靠的運行狀態(tài)。
Linux init進程主要實現(xiàn)了以下功能:首先,它負責(zé)啟動并初始化內(nèi)核空間,包括內(nèi)核空間地址映射、內(nèi)存管理等;其次,它完成了用戶態(tài)服務(wù)的啟動,可以根據(jù)所需要的服務(wù)類型(如網(wǎng)絡(luò)服務(wù)、定時服務(wù)等)來加載和啟動用戶態(tài)服務(wù);最后,它還會負責(zé)初始化系統(tǒng),加載并啟動進程樹上的其他進程,從而保證操作系統(tǒng)的正常運行。
從技術(shù)實現(xiàn)的角度來講,Linux init進程是通過一個內(nèi)嵌的C代碼(分別存放在/lib/init、/lib/init/initramfs.cpio.gz文件里)以及一系列shell腳本完成的。比如/etc/init.d/下的腳本可以用來啟動和停止系統(tǒng)服務(wù),/etc/rc.d/rc.sysinit文件用于初始化系統(tǒng)環(huán)境變量,/etc/inittab文件則可以定義默認的運行級別等等。
總之,Linux init進程是Linux系統(tǒng)正確運行的可靠基礎(chǔ),它的重要性不言而喻,而其實現(xiàn)的技術(shù)原理也十分重要。
成都網(wǎng)站建設(shè)選創(chuàng)新互聯(lián)(?:028-86922220),專業(yè)從事成都網(wǎng)站制作設(shè)計,高端小程序APP定制開發(fā),成都網(wǎng)絡(luò)營銷推廣等一站式服務(wù)。
網(wǎng)站標(biāo)題:深入剖析LinuxInit進程的重要性與實現(xiàn)原理(linuxinit進程)
本文鏈接:http://m.5511xx.com/article/djsieop.html


咨詢
建站咨詢
